Paulette Sears
Department Chair; Modern dance, Laban Movement Studies, Labanotation
Choreographer, performer, and nationally recognized
teacher in Laban Movement Studies; work produced at Joyce Soho, Cunningham
Studio, Symphony Space, P.S. 122, Eden's Expressway, and Nikolais-Louis
Choreospace; recognized at regional American College Dance Festivals, and by
The New Jersey State Council on the Arts/Department of State with a
Choreography Fellowship; invited to perform in Brazil; taught in Europe, and
in the U.S. at the Laban/Bartenieff Institute of Movement Studies, Dance
Notation Bureau, Omega Institute, and other schools; performed in N.Y.'s
dancenow festival; performed in works by Claire Porter as part of the 40Up
Project at St. Mark's Church; community performer with Mikhail Baryshnikov's
White Oak Dance Project.
